Coppernico Metals Launches C$5 Million Private Placement

Coppernico Metals (COPR.TO) seeks to raise C$5 million in a private placement to advance development of the Sombrero Project in Peru, the company said Thursday.The company plans to use the proceeds to advance drill permitting and additional community agreements to support future exploration activities at the project, as well as for general corporate and working capital purposes.The offering consists of 14,285,714 units priced at $0.35 apiece. Each unit will be comprised of one common share and one share purchase warrant exercisable at $0.50 per share for 24 months.Closing is expected June 26.

Coppernico Metals Posts Channel Sampling Results from Nioc Target Area of Sombrero Project

Additional surface channel sampling results from the Nioc target area at the Sombrero copper-gold project in Peru expand the known surface footprint of copper-gold mineralization at Zone 2, Coppernico Metals (COPR.TO) said on Tuesday.The results also "materially de-risk" initial drill targeting decisions by demonstrating continuous, high-grade skarn mineralization across a broad footprint directly above a large, coherent geophysical anomaly, while the company's interpretation of Nioc as a large scary system genetically linked to a porphyry-style intrusive center, "with significant exploration upside", was also reinforced, it added.Highlights of the results include 70.1 meters of 0.92% copper, 0.25 grams per tonne gold and 2.45 g/t silver; and 58.0 m of 0.58% copper, 0.39 g/t gold and 1.70 g/t silver.The results nearly double the width of surface mineralization at Zone 2 to about 70 m in the east-west direction relative to the previously reported 36 metres.Combined Zone 1 and Zone 2 results now define a broad, still-open surface expression of copper-gold skarn mineralization above the more-than-1.5-kilometer Nioc coincident geophysical target, strengthening confidence in initial drill targeting across the target area.Shares in COPR rose 8.2% last Friday, before the holiday weekend.

Coppernico Metals Advances Tipicancha Copper-Gold Target in Peru Ahead of Initial Drilling

Coppernico Metals (COPR.TO) plans to drill test the Tipicancha copper-gold target at its Sombrero project in Peru, the company said Monday.Systematic mapping is materially refining the scale, geometry and structural framework of the target, which is now interpreted to extend over more than 4 kilometers in length, the company said."The partially outcropping Tipicancha target is emerging as one of our most compelling exploration targets at Sombrero, which we plan to drill test in the coming months," Chair and Chief Executive Officer Ivan Bebek said."The strong correlation between surface sampling in areas of limited bedrock exposure, recent geophysical studies, and these latest results continues to strengthen our confidence in the near-surface continuity of the pyrite-copper horizon," Bebek added.
